Leucine Content in 3 Ounces of Chicken
For many, chicken is a staple source of protein, especially for those focused on fitness and muscle development. When it comes to specific amino acids, leucine is a primary focus due to its role in stimulating muscle protein synthesis (MPS). The amount of leucine in a 3-ounce serving can vary slightly depending on the cut and preparation, but boneless, skinless chicken breast is a particularly rich source.
A 3-ounce (85 gram) portion of cooked, boneless, and skinless chicken breast contains approximately 2.5 grams of leucine. This amount is significant because it meets or exceeds the anabolic threshold believed to be necessary for activating the muscle-building process in the body. This makes chicken breast an excellent choice for a post-workout meal or a high-protein dinner.
Cooked vs. Raw Chicken
It is important to note that nutritional figures for chicken are most commonly cited for cooked meat. The cooking process causes the chicken to lose moisture, concentrating the protein and amino acids. This means that a 3-ounce serving of raw chicken would contain less protein and, therefore, less leucine than an equivalent weight of cooked chicken. When tracking macronutrients, it is best to use data for cooked meat to avoid underestimating your intake.
The Crucial Role of Leucine
Leucine is one of the three branched-chain amino acids (BCAAs), along with isoleucine and valine. It is considered an “essential” amino acid because the body cannot produce it and it must be obtained through diet. Its standout function is its ability to directly trigger the mTOR (mechanistic target of rapamycin) signaling pathway, which regulates cell growth, including muscle protein synthesis.
Benefits of Adequate Leucine Intake
- Stimulates Muscle Protein Synthesis: Leucine acts as a primary signaling molecule that initiates the repair and building of new muscle tissue.
- Reduces Muscle Protein Breakdown: By promoting synthesis, leucine helps prevent the breakdown of muscle tissue, which is especially important during caloric deficits or periods of inactivity.
- Aids in Exercise Recovery: Consuming leucine after resistance training can accelerate muscle repair and reduce recovery time.
- Supports Weight Management: By preserving muscle mass during weight loss, leucine helps maintain a higher metabolic rate, aiding in fat loss efforts.
- Counters Age-Related Muscle Loss: For older adults, leucine can be particularly beneficial in mitigating sarcopenia, the natural decline in muscle mass that occurs with aging.
Leucine Content: Chicken vs. Other Foods
While chicken is a top-tier source, many other foods also contain high amounts of leucine. Varying your protein sources can provide a wider range of micronutrients and amino acids for overall health.
| Food Source | Serving Size | Leucine (grams) |
|---|---|---|
| Cooked Chicken Breast | 3 oz (85g) | ~2.5 |
| Beef Round Steak, cooked | 3 oz (85g) | ~2.4 |
| Canned Tuna (in water) | 3 oz (85g) | ~1.7 |
| Large Egg | 1 large | ~0.6 |
| Cooked Lentils | 1 cup | ~1.7 |
| Dry Roasted Peanuts | 1 cup | ~2.2 |
| Plain Greek Yogurt | 1 cup | ~1.2 |
Optimizing Leucine and Protein Intake
While leucine is a powerful signal for muscle growth, it works best in the context of a complete protein. For sustained muscle protein synthesis, the body requires all essential amino acids, not just leucine. Therefore, a food-first approach, prioritizing complete protein sources like chicken, is the most effective strategy for most individuals.
For active people or older adults, targeting around 2.5-3 grams of leucine per meal can optimize muscle-building signals. This is easily achieved with a 3-ounce serving of chicken breast. Pairing this with other high-leucine foods, such as dairy or legumes, can help reach daily intake goals.
